您当前的位置:首页 > TAG信息列表 > wp-query
Unable to pass variable
我正在尝试从widget传递post-show的数量。我将其存储为$条目我的代码<?php query_posts( array(\'post_type\' => array(\'post\'),\'order\' => \'DESC\',\'posts_per_page\' => \'.$entry.\') ); ?> 谢谢
将POST数据重置为嵌套循环中的前一个循环
我正在尝试将嵌套循环与posts-to-posts插件结合使用。这两个循环都可以工作,但问题出现在第二个嵌套循环($问题)之后。我想再次访问$publication循环,但数据仍然是$issue数据。wp_reset_query() 将在单回路中重置回主回路。我不想要的php。我可以用get_posts() 而不是新的WP\\u查询,但我希望能够使用get_template_part().如何将数据重置回发布循环,以便第二个“发布标题”返回的是发布,而不是问题标题?这是我的代码。php:$publicat
如果查询返回的帖子在自定义字段中具有匹配的ID,我如何使用WP_Query仅显示来自自定义帖子类型的1个帖子
我到处寻找解决方案,但什么也找不到;希望这里有比我更熟练的人能帮忙。每次加载页面时,我都会随机显示两个推荐视频(来自视频自定义帖子类型)。有不同的客户有鉴定书,在某些情况下,同一客户有多份鉴定书。我的查询可以随机显示自定义帖子类型中的两个视频(同时完全过滤掉一个类别)。我试图避免的是从同一个客户端加载两个推荐视频(显示两个相同的缩略图看起来很奇怪),但我不知道如何做到这一点。以下是我目前掌握的工作代码: <?php $loop = new WP_Query(array(
将多个WP_Query优化为一个调用?
我已经完成了我的网站建设,并注意到由于结构原因,由于每个WP\\U查询在不同的帖子类型之间跳转,加载数据需要3秒钟。我想知道我是否将这些放在一个函数运行中,这样就不必每次都运行一个数组,这是否会产生任何有益的效果?遗憾的是,目前我已经尝试:function get_gametitle_info() { global $post; $game_terms = get_the_terms($post, \'games_titles\'); $game_con = w
在Parents Single.php上查询子帖子?
是否可以查询您的单个帖子的子帖子?i、 e您有一个名为Apple的自定义帖子类型。父页是。。。单个苹果。php在该页面上查询并显示其所有子级,以及相应的链接。。Apple父级--Apple子级--苹果的孩子--苹果的孩子。然而,当你点击它时,它会将其带到自己的单曲。php用于apple儿童。那叫什么?好吧。。独生子女。php??
在WordPress之外无法获得附件吗?
我的页面(在wordpress安装之外)的开头是这样的:global $wpdb, $wp_query; define(\'WP_USE_THEMES\', false); include_once \'word/wp-blog-header.php\'; $args = array( \'posts_per_page\' => 10, \'post_type\' => \'post\' ); $quer
自定义wp_查询分页-NEXT_POST_LINK()或wp_Pagenavi()始终为空
我知道这是一个讨论到了极点的话题,但我已经阅读了许多解决方案,无法理解为什么我的分页根本不起作用。我有一个非常简单的自定义wp\\U查询:$current_page = (get_query_var(\'paged\')) ? get_query_var(\'paged\') : 1; $project_query = new WP_query(array( \'post_type\' => \'project\', \'paged\' => $cur
首先按元键对列表进行排序的查询(如果存在),并按标题显示没有元键的剩余帖子
我正在开发一个自定义分类术语页面模板,我们希望连接到术语的项目按发布日期(自定义日期字段)排序,如果同一天有多个项目(格式为YYYY-MM-DD),则按标题排序,如果自定义字段未填写,则按标题排序(旧项目)。因此,我用WP\\u查询尝试了100种不同的方法,它确实会按我的需要返回大多数结果,但在本例中,它只返回具有publication\\u date的meta\\u键的项目。所有其他项目将被忽略且不显示。我尝试了一个使用“or”关系的meta\\u查询,并将publication\\u日期比较为EXIS
正在检索不同帖子类型的子页面的ID
我有一个普通的页面,在自定义的帖子类型中有子页面。我尝试根据参数的子项\\u获取\\u页面,但它没有返回任何结果。最好的方法是什么?
我如何从5个帖子的查询中获得1个最新帖子?
所以我有一个wp_query 这是从我的Wordpress网站上获得的5篇最新帖子。我想做的是在这个查询中,抓取最新的帖子并将其显示为一种“英雄”帖子,然后获取其他4篇帖子(如果我以后更改查询,可能会超过4篇),并在这个英雄帖子下面的列表或网格中显示。以下是我迄今为止的查询代码(明显简化):<?php $query_args = array( \"posts_per_page\" => \"5\" ); $listedPosts =
使用多个循环从自定义WP_QUERY中排除最近更新的帖子
我想做这样的事情,但我想不出来。[单击][1]我正在使用此自定义WP\\U查询在我的主页上显示即将发生的事件。 $events_args = array( \'post_type\' => VA_EVENT_PTYPE, \'posts_per_page\' => $number, \'no_found_rows\' => true, \'post_status\' =>
WP_QUERY未获取所有帖子,仅获取已标记的帖子
我正在尝试创建一个归档页面,该页面可以抓取提交的所有帖子。目前,我有一个不起作用的问题:<?php $args = array (); $query = new WP_Query( $args ); if ( $query->have_posts() ) { while ( $query->have_posts() ) { $query->the_post();?>
仅显示一定数量的帖子,具体取决于查询中可用帖子的数量
我正在尝试为一个帖子滑块编写一些代码,目前我的代码涉及两个WP_Querys、 一个在另一个里面,但我忍不住觉得可能有一种更有效的方式来实现我想要实现的目标。步骤包括:使用WP\\u查询,检查某一帖子类型的已发布帖子数量=4,我想在页面中添加一个滑块,所以我开始打印滑块容器</然后在滑动HTML中,我使用第一个WP\\U查询中的帖子数($num_posts) 计算出我想在下一次查询中打印多少帖子。如果有>=12可用,我想打印全部12。如果有8到11个,我只想打印8个。如果有4到7个可用,我只想
如何在WordPress查询中添加限制记录
我有一个查询,它从类型等于“quote2”的数据库返回所有记录。不,我想知道如何限制记录。我的意思是,我只想显示数据库中添加的最后10条记录。我是wordpress新手,想学习所需查询的语法。global $wpdb; $querystr = \"select $wpdb->posts.* FROM $wpdb->posts WHERE $wpdb->posts.post_type = \'quote2\' \";
如何更改循环上的默认POST类型?
我想在默认查询中包括一些帖子。循环开始时: if ( have_posts() ) : // Start the Loop. while ( have_posts() ) : the_post(); 默认post类型为\'post\', 因此其他类型的帖子不会进入循环(例如,我有一个自定义的帖子类型,名为\'news\').我可以使用WP查询对象并执行以下操作: $type = \'news\';
如何从SQL中返回值并进行显示
在普通php中,我认为没有这种问题,但在WP中,情况就不同了。我有一个查询,我想从“liczba\\u wodo”列返回一个值。global $wpdb; if (isset($_POST[\'submit\'])){ $spr_liczbe_wodo = $wpdb->get_row (\"select liczba_wodo from wp_ow_adres where adres=\'Street 12/6\'\"); foreach (
使用自定义帖子类型的分页在index.php上不起作用:我得到一个404
我读过很多关于同一问题的帖子,但似乎没有一篇对我有用。我在索引中查询了一个自定义帖子。php。当我转到第2页时,我得到一个404错误。相同的代码在任何静态页面中都像一个符咒一样工作。<?php get_header(); ?> <div id=\"content\"> <div id=\"inner-content\" class=\"wrap clearfix\">
WP_Query->设置多个类别
$wp_query->set( \'cat\', \'1, 2, 3\' ) 类似于sql查询的表单term_id IN (1, 2, 3) 但我需要term_id = 1 AND term_id = 2 AND term_id = 3` 如何使用$wp_query->set()?
用修改后的分页在主循环上的偶数位置添加类别
我在主回路上显示了不同的类别。我想在主回路的偶数位置添加一个特定类别的帖子。当前帖子列表的类别示例:cat1 cat1 cat1 cat1 cat1所需:cat1 catA cat1 catA cat1 catA cat1 catA cat1 catA cat1 catA我用它跳过当前的分类帖子,但无法将所需的分类帖子添加到它的位置。<?php if($wp_query->current_post%2==1 && in_category(\'cat1\')) continue;
使用ID按多个类别检索最新帖子
我的product 岗位类型。Category Name: Test 1 ID: 82 Category Name: Test 2 ID: 83 Category Name: Test 3 ID: 84 Category Name: Test 4 ID: 85 现在,我想为每个类别检索一篇文章——最后添加的一篇。我试过下面的代码,但效果不好。<?php $args = array( \'product_cat_\' => 82,83,84,85